""A History of the Republican Party"" is a book written by George Washington Platt in 1904. The book provides a comprehensive account of the origins, development, and achievements of the Republican Party in the United States. The author traces the party's roots back to the mid-19th century and highlights the key figures and events that shaped its ideology and policies. Platt also discusses the party's role in major historical events such as the Civil War, Reconstruction, and the Gilded Age. The book covers the Republican Party's stance on key issues such as civil rights, women's suffrage, and economic policy. Additionally, the author provides a critical analysis of the party's successes and failures over the years.
